Fiat Chrysler Automobiles NV is “not in a position” to discuss a merger with Volkswagen AG and instead will focus on its own business plan, CEO Sergio Marchionne tells investors.
“We need to be very careful that we don’t start unrealistic dreams about consolidation,” Marchionne adds.
Last month Marchionne, who believes further consolidation within the auto industry is inevitable, floated the notion of a tie-up between the companies. He opined that VW might favor the move to offset PSA Group’s purchase of General Motors’ Opel unit in Europe.
An initially skeptical VW CEO Matthias Mueller later indicated tentative interest in discussing the idea. But Marchionne, who is expected to retire in early 2019, says there are no ongoing discussions between the companies.
